+/**
+ * Formats a given value into a representation using SI units.
+ *
+ * If 'prefix' is left 'unspecified', the function chooses a prefix so that
+ * the value in front of the decimal point is between 1 and 999.
+ *
+ * @param value The value to format.
+ * @param prefix The SI prefix to use.
+ * @param precision The number of digits after the decimal separator.
+ * @param unit The unit of quantity.
+ * @param sign Whether or not to add a sign also for positive numbers.
+ *
+ * @return The formatted value.
+ */
+QString format_value_si(double v,
+ SIPrefix prefix = SIPrefix::unspecified, unsigned precision = 0,
+ QString unit = "", bool sign = true);
